12) how much more interest is earned if $8,500 is invested into an account paying compound interest of 4% for 6 years compared to investing the $8,500 into an account paying simple interest of 4.5% for 5 years?
Answer
Explanation:
Step1: Calculate compound - interest amount
The compound - interest formula is $A = P(1 + r)^t$, where $P=$8500$, $r = 0.04$, and $t = 6$. $A_{1}=8500\times(1 + 0.04)^{6}=8500\times1.04^{6}\approx8500\times1.265319018496\approx10755.21$ The compound interest $I_{1}=A_{1}-P=10755.21 - 8500=$2255.21$
Step2: Calculate simple - interest amount
The simple - interest formula is $I = Prt$, where $P = 8500$, $r=0.045$, and $t = 5$. $I_{2}=8500\times0.045\times5=8500\times0.225=$1912.5$
Step3: Find the difference in interest
$I = I_{1}-I_{2}=2255.21-1912.5=$342.71$
Answer:
$342.71$
